Common Causes of Roller Door Failure
There are a few patterns we see often on busy commercial sites, especially where doors are used many times per day.

Lack of Regular Servicing
Dust, grime, and wear can build up slowly. Springs and rollers can weaken over time, and then the door suddenly becomes hard to move or stops. Routine checks can catch small issues early and reduce surprise breakdowns.
General Wear From Daily Use
Every open and close puts stress on the moving parts. On high-traffic sites, parts can wear out sooner.
Warning signs include new noises, uneven movement, or a door that feels heavier than normal.
Motor and Control Problems
Automatic roller doors rely on motors, wiring, and safety devices to work as they should. When any of these fail, the door may stop mid-cycle, refuse to open, or behave in an unsafe way.
If the fault is in the wiring or controls, our electrician team can diagnose it and fix it so the system runs safely again.
Track and Alignment Issues
Tracks can bend after impact, or debris can get into the guide area. Even small alignment issues can cause jamming and extra strain on other parts.
We straighten, realign, and repair tracks so the door moves cleanly and does not keep binding.

Understanding Compliance and Safety Standards
Commercial roller doors are heavy and can be dangerous when they fail. Safe repair work helps protect staff, tenants, and the public, and it can also reduce risk during audits or insurance checks.
Australian Standards for Commercial Roller Doors
Commercial roller door repairs should align with relevant Australian Standards, including AS/NZS 4505 and AS/NZS 1170. These standards cover safe operation and structural performance, including things like emergency release and wind load resistance.
